I believe I have the fix for the problem were xinput reports "AlpsPS/2
ALPS GlidePoint" then if you suspend the system it loads up as "PS/2
ALPS GlidePoint" touchpad not working the same. Here is the list of what
I did to fix the problem this also includes fix the disabling the Tap
on the Touchpads.
1) Need to edit the /usr/share/hal/fdi/policy/20thirdparty/11-x11-synaptics.fdi
a) $ sudo nano -w
/usr/share/hal/fdi/policy/20thirdparty/11-x11-synaptics.fdi
b) login
2) Need to add the follow lines just before the this section <match
key="info.product" contains="AlpsPS/2 ALPS">
<match key="info.product" contains="PS/2 ALPS">
<merge key="input.x11_driver" type="string">synaptics</merge>
<merge key="input.x11_options.MaxTapTime" type="string">0</merge>
</match>
Note: Need to add the line <merge key="input.x11_options.MaxTapTime"
type="string">0</merge> into the match section for the <match
key="info.product" contains="AlpsPS/2 ALPS"> to get the tap turned off
there also.
I have test this and it does work for me under xubuntu 8.10.
